UVA 439 Knight move

A friend of you is doing research on the Traveling Knight Problem (TKP) where you are to find the shortest closed tour of knight moves that visits each square of a given set of n squares on a chessboard
exactly once. He thinks that the most difficult part of the problem is determining the smallest number of knight moves between two given squares and that, once you have accomplished this, finding the tour would be easy.

Of course you know that it is vice versa. So you offer him to write a program that solves the "difficult" part.

 

Your job is to write a program that takes two squares a and b as input and then determines the number of knight moves on a shortest route from a to b.

 

Input Specification

The input file will contain one or more test cases. Each test case consists of one line containing two squares separated by one space. A square is a string consisting of a letter (a-h) representing the
column and a digit (1-8) representing the row on the chessboard.

 

Output Specification

For each test case, print one line saying "To get from xx to yy takes n knight moves.".

 

Sample Input

 

e2 e4
a1 b2
b2 c3
a1 h8
a1 h7
h8 a1
b1 c3
f6 f6

 

Sample Output

 

To get from e2 to e4 takes 2 knight moves.
To get from a1 to b2 takes 4 knight moves.
To get from b2 to c3 takes 2 knight moves.
To get from a1 to h8 takes 6 knight moves.
To get from a1 to h7 takes 5 knight moves.
To get from h8 to a1 takes 6 knight moves.
To get from b1 to c3 takes 1 knight moves.
To get from f6 to f6 takes 0 knight moves.

#include<cstdio>
#include<iostream>
#include<algorithm>
#include<queue>
#include<cstring>
using namespace std;
int dir[][2] = {
  {-2,-1},{-2,1},{2,1},{2,-1},{1,2},{1,-2},{-1,-2},{-1,2}};//马的移动

int a[10][10],ex,ey;
char s1[5],s2[5];

struct node
{
    int x;
    int y;
    int step;
};
bool check(int x,int y)
{
    if(x < 0 || y < 0 || x >= 8 || y >= 8 || a[x][y])
        return true;
    return false;
}
int bfs()
{

    queue<node> Q;
    node p,next,q;
    p.x = s1[0] - 'a';
    p.y = s1[1] - '1';
    p.step = 0;
    ex = s2[0] - 'a';
    ey = s2[1] - '1';
    memset(a,0,sizeof(a));
    a[p.x][p.y] = 1;
    Q.push(p);
    while(!Q.empty())
    {
        q = Q.front();
        Q.pop();
        if(q.x == ex && q.y == ey)
            return q.step;
        for(int i = 0 ; i < 8; i++)
        {
            next.x = q.x + dir[i][0];
            next.y = q.y + dir[i][1];
            if(next.x == ex && next.y == ey)
                return q.step + 1;
            if(check(next.x,next.y))
                continue;
            next.step = q.step + 1;
            a[next.x][next.y] = 1;
            Q.push(next);
        }
    }
    return 0;
}
int main()
{
    while(scanf("%s %s",s1,s2)!=EOF)
    {
        printf("To get from %s to %s takes %d knight moves.\n",s1,s2,bfs());
    }
    return 0;
}

Catch That Cow   POJ 3278

Description

Farmer John has been informed of the location of a fugitive cow and wants to catch her immediately. He starts at a point N (0 ≤ N ≤ 100,000) on a number line and the cow is at a point K (0 ≤ K ≤ 100,000) on the same number line. Farmer John has two modes of transportation: walking and teleporting.

* Walking: FJ can move from any point X to the points - 1 or + 1 in a single minute
* Teleporting: FJ can move from any point X to the point 2 × X in a single minute.

If the cow, unaware of its pursuit, does not move at all, how long does it take for Farmer John to retrieve it?

Input

Line 1: Two space-separated integers: N and K

Output

Line 1: The least amount of time, in minutes, it takes for Farmer John to catch the fugitive cow.
